The Outer Circle is extremely popular with road cyclists, who use it for training laps, often first thing in the morning, but it is also a commuting route for cyclists. The land remained rural countryside until the 19th century when John Nash was Architect to the Woods and Forests Department, and friend of the Prince of Wales, the future King George IV. What is now Regent's Park came into possession of the Crown upon the dissolution of the monasteries in the 1500s, and was used for hunting and tenant farming. The northern side of the park is the home of London Zoo and the headquarters of the Zoological Society of London. [10], Contrary to popular belief, the dominant architectural influence in many of the Regent's Park projects including Cornwall Terrace, York Terrace, Chester Terrace, Clarence Terrace, and the villas of the Inner Circle, all of which were constructed by James Burton's company[9] was Decimus Burton, not John Nash, who was appointed architectural "overseer" for Decimus's projects. Of their style Allinson and Thornton wrote that, But these villas are more Palladian than the informal Tuscan villa rustica format preferred by Nash at Park Village. [10] To the chagrin of Nash, Decimus largely disregarded his advice and developed the Terraces according to his own style, to the extent that Nash sought the demolition and complete rebuilding of Chester Terrace, but in vain.
